NPC members may also campaign for own bets - Sotto


By Vanne Elaine Terrazola 

Members of the Nationalist People's Coalition (NPC) will be allowed to campaign for their own bets apart from the party's official slate for the 2019 senatorial elections.

Senate President Vicente Sotto III said the NPC was expected to release soon its list of senatorial candidates for the May 2019 midterm elections as the filing of the certificates of candidacy (COC) comes to a close on Wednesday, October 17.

"Ang agreement namin (We agreed that), after the 17th, kung maliwanag na kung sino-sino yung mga kandidato (when those who are running are clear and final), the NPC will come up with a list of senatorial candidates that they will support. That means, from top to ground, tutulungan namin (we would help them). Sa mga lugar na kontrolado namin, ikakampanya namin sila (We will campaign for them in areas that we control)," Sotto, a senior member of the NPC council, told reporters.

But Sotto said the NPC will only have eight to nine names on their slate. This, he said, would give their members enough "elbow room" to support their personal bets.

Even NPC chairman Eduardo "Danding" Cojuangco Jr. will endorse other candidates in his personal capacity.

"Siya (Cojuangco) rin, meron siyang mga tatlo, apat na gustong matulungan na maaaring wala doon sa list. Ako rin, baka may mga dalawa, tatlo na wala doon sa NPC list na gusto kong tulungan pero ikakampanya ko pa rin," Sotto said.

Sotto said the NPC slate would "definitely" be led by NPC candidates Sen. Joseph Victor Ejercito, former Sen. Lito Lapid, and honorary member Sen. Grace Poe.

He said the NPC will hold one or two campaign rallies wherein they will invite their senatorial candidates for the 2019 polls.
